英 [riˈæktənt] 美 [riˈæktənt]

n. [化学] 反应物;反应剂[1]

reactant gas 反应气体

fibre reactant 纤维交链剂

limiting reactant 限制反应物 ; 反应物 ; 限量反应物

acute phase reactant 急性期反应物 ; 物质 ; 血中急性反应相物质

reactant ratio 推进剂组分比

external reactant 外加剂

unconverted reactant 未转化反应物

excess reactant 过量反应物[1]
